I have been part of this recruitment process before, and I can give some insight to how the process was
The test being invited for now is a general aptitude with the usual numeric, verbal and spatial stuffs.
The next test will be the skill test. I can give some points on the one for the Petroleum Engineers
The entire questions are theory questions (not obj). There were two sections. One was optional (like 8 to answer 6 or so). For the second (around six or so), all the questions were to be attempted.
Like dynamo said, a large part of the questions were Pet engr questions, mainly reservoir stuffs. The units were field units and not SI. There were also stuffs on mechanics and electricity.
The test was a lot skewed to favour Pet Engr graduates. For peeps that are not, u will have no choice but to do a lot of reading on reservour stuffs
But then, I think everyone should focus on the aptitude test for now...it can also be challenging as well
